The consumer placed a claim for an Air Conditioner not cooling on 7/20/2020. The vendor reported that the capacitor was bad on the unit. After replacing the capacitor to get the unit started, it was determined there was an internal failure on the compressor. Total Home Protection determined the compressor failure is due to an internal mechanical failure. This failure is caused from the compressor overheating and damaging the internal components of the compressor and not normal wear & tear. Per our policy this failure is clearly excluded from coverage. Please see the referenced section of the policy below;

I. BASIS FOR COVERAGE

During the term of this Agreement, we agree to pay the covered costs to repair or replace the items listed as covered on your Agreement Coverage Summary if any such items become inoperable due to mechanical failure caused by normal wear and tear. Determination of Coverage including the operational condition as of the Agreement effective date for any claim will be made solely by us, considering but not limited to, our independent contractor’s diagnosis, hereinafter referred to as the “Service Contractor”. This Agreement does not cover any known or unknown pre-existing conditions. It is understood that WE ARE NOT A SERVICE CONTRACTOR and is not itself undertaking to repair or replace any such systems or components. This Agreement covers single-family homes, new construction homes, condominiums, townhomes, and mobile homes under 5,000 square feet, unless an alternative dwelling type (i.e. above 5,000 square feet or multi-unit home) is applied, and appropriate fees are paid. This Agreement will not cover systems or appliances within (a) commercial properties; (b) residential properties used for business purposes, including, but not limited to, dwellings used for rest homes, day care centers, schools and/or professional offices; (c) common areas of condominiums, multi-family houses and/or cooperatives; (d) vacant properties, and; (e) foreclosed/short sold properties. Coverage applies to the systems and components mentioned as “covered” in accordance with the terms and conditions of this Agreement so long as such systems and components:

A. Become inoperable due to normal wear and tear; and

The consumer placed a claim on 01/07/20 for the refrigerator stating that the unit was not cooling adequately. The vendor reported that the ice maker on the unit was not making ice. Per the policy the ice maker is not covered under the Refrigerator coverage; it is an additional coverage that would need to be purchased with the policy.

In an effort to assist the customer, Total Home Protection offered a good will amount to go towards the uncovered repair/replacement. The consumer denied the good will amount. It was then offered to add the coverage to his account at a prorated cost appropriate to the time left on the consumer’s term. The consumer denied this option.

The consumer also placed a claim on 12/30/19 for a Built-In Microwave stating that unit was not heating adequately. The vendor reported that the magnetron assembly and diode had failed. The vendor indicated that due to unit’s age, repair was not an option.

As per the policy, we offered the consumer a buy-out amount for the unit. This was denied. In an effort to further assist the consumer, the amount was increased and the consumer accepted. The consumer was advised to allow 30 business days (equaling 6 weeks) to allow the check to authorize and mail out. The consumer understood.
